Understanding Lifting Beams and Spreader Beams

Wiki Article

A hoisting girder and a spreading beam are essential components within heavy burden hoisting operations . Usually , a hoisting girder is like a sturdy assembly designed to share the load across various hoisting points , minimizing stress on separate hoisting points and preventing harm to the burden or a lifting apparatus. In contrast , a spreader beam mainly serves to widen the gap between raising locations , enhancing stability and permitting the safe movement of bulky goods.

Secure Hoisting Procedures with Hoist Girders

Employing lifting beams safely requires thorough planning and adherence to recommended practices . Always verify the beam’s integrity before each use , checking for defects . Ensure the load is securely centered on the girder and that the lifting machinery , such as the crane , has an adequate capacity for the total mass . Never go beyond the girder's maximum capacity, and remember to account for the inclination of the lift , as this will affect the strains on the structure. Adhere to producer's guidance and regional standards.

Hoisting Girders vs. Spreader Girders: The Variance?

Numerous workers mix up lifting bars and spreader bars, but they fulfill different roles in heavy raising processes. A raising girder is usually a strong structural element used to join the raising equipment to the item being shifted. Essentially, it delivers a primary point for fastening. In contrast, a dispersal girder is designed to distribute the cargo's mass across a larger area, diminishing pressure on the raising gear and the item personally. Therefore, while both are essential to safe lifting, their functions are not the same.
